4. Vitamin B12 Deficiency

4. Vitamin B12 Deficiency
A bright vitamin B12 tablet rests beside a fresh assortment of leafy greens, highlighting a balanced approach to nutrition. | Generated by Google Gemini

Vitamin B12 plays a crucial role in maintaining nerve health and supporting memory retention. This essential nutrient is involved in the formation of myelin, the protective sheath around nerves, and in the production of neurotransmitters critical for brain function. A deficiency in B12 can manifest as forgetfulness, confusion, or even symptoms that mimic dementia, as highlighted by the NHS.
Dietary gaps are a common cause, especially for individuals following plant-based diets, as B12 is primarily found in animal products like meat, dairy, and eggs. People who avoid these foods may be at increased risk unless they consume fortified products or supplements. According to the National Institutes of Health, older adults and those with certain digestive conditions are also more susceptible to poor B12 absorption.
If you experience unexplained memory lapses, consider speaking with your healthcare provider about screening for B12 deficiency. Dietary sources include fish, poultry, eggs, and fortified breakfast cereals. For those on vegetarian or vegan diets, B12 supplements or fortified foods are recommended to maintain optimal brain and nerve health and to protect memory over time.

11. Antihistamine Overuse

11. Antihistamine Overuse
A close-up of white antihistamine pills scattered beside their packaging, ready to provide fast-acting allergy relief. | Generated by Google Gemini

Many people rely on antihistamines to manage seasonal allergies, but overusing some of these medications can have unintended effects on memory. Certain first-generation antihistamines, like diphenhydramine (Benadryl), cross the blood-brain barrier and interfere with acetylcholine, a neurotransmitter essential for memory and learning. According to the Alzheimer’s Association, chronic use of these medications is linked to increased risk of cognitive decline, especially in older adults.
If you suffer from seasonal allergies and frequently reach for over-the-counter relief, you might notice increased forgetfulness or trouble focusing during allergy season. This isn’t just due to the discomfort of allergies—some antihistamines themselves can dull memory and slow mental processing.
If you rely on antihistamines, talk to your healthcare provider about safer alternatives, such as second-generation antihistamines, which are less likely to cause cognitive side effects. Always use the lowest effective dose and avoid taking these medicines longer than necessary. By staying informed and proactive, allergy sufferers can manage symptoms without sacrificing memory or mental clarity.

14. Untreated Sleep Apnea

14. Untreated Sleep Apnea
A man rests peacefully in bed wearing a CPAP mask, finally finding relief from loud, nightly snoring. | Generated by Google Gemini

Untreated sleep apnea can take a silent toll on memory and cognitive function. This condition causes repeated pauses in breathing during sleep, leading to brief but frequent drops in oxygen levels. Over time, these interruptions can impair the hippocampus and other brain regions responsible for consolidating and retrieving memories. According to the Sleep Foundation, people with sleep apnea often report forgetfulness, difficulty concentrating, and feeling mentally sluggish during the day.
One of the most common warning signs is loud, persistent snoring—something often noticed by partners before the individual is aware. Other symptoms can include morning headaches, dry mouth, and unrefreshing sleep, all of which may be overlooked or attributed to other causes.
If you experience chronic snoring, excessive daytime fatigue, or frequent memory lapses, consider asking your healthcare provider about a sleep study. Early diagnosis and treatment, such as using a CPAP machine or making lifestyle adjustments, can dramatically improve sleep quality and restore cognitive sharpness. Addressing sleep apnea is a critical step toward protecting and enhancing long-term memory health.

25. Overuse of Antacids

25. Overuse of Antacids
A bottle of antacids sits beside a graphic of a stomach, illustrating quick relief from heartburn discomfort. | Generated by Google Gemini

Frequent or long-term use of antacids, especially proton pump inhibitors and H2 blockers, can quietly undermine memory by interfering with the absorption of vital nutrients. These medications reduce stomach acid, which is necessary for the body to absorb minerals like magnesium, calcium, and especially vitamin B12—all important for healthy brain function. The National Institutes of Health has linked chronic antacid use to vitamin B12 deficiency, which can manifest as memory lapses and mental fog.
Many people treat ongoing heartburn or acid reflux with daily antacids, never realizing that the underlying cause might be dietary or lifestyle-related. By masking symptoms without addressing root triggers, they may unknowingly compromise their long-term cognitive health.
If you find yourself relying on antacids regularly, it’s wise to review your diet and habits—such as meal timing, portion sizes, and trigger foods—with a healthcare provider. Ask about alternative treatments or nutrient supplementation if needed. Addressing the root cause of acid reflux, rather than just the symptoms, can help prevent nutrient deficiencies and support optimal memory and brain performance.

41. Exposure to Lead

41. Exposure to Lead
Old metal pipes coated with chipping lead paint run along a basement wall, highlighting hidden household safety concerns. | Generated by Google Gemini

Lead is a potent neurotoxin that can severely impair memory and cognitive abilities, even at low levels of exposure. Found in old paint, aging water pipes, and contaminated soil, lead can accumulate in the body and disrupt nervous system function. According to the Centers for Disease Control and Prevention (CDC), lead poisoning has been linked to developmental delays and memory loss in children, as well as cognitive decline in adults.
Public health incidents, such as the Flint water crisis, highlight the severe consequences of lead exposure on brain health. Symptoms can include forgetfulness, trouble concentrating, mood changes, and learning difficulties. The effects are often gradual and may go unnoticed until significant damage has occurred.
To protect yourself and your family, consider testing your home for lead if it was built before 1978 or if you suspect old plumbing. Professional remediation, such as replacing pipes or safely removing lead paint, is crucial for reducing risk. Simple preventive steps can make a significant difference in safeguarding your memory and overall cognitive well-being.
